Danish pension giant Arbejdsmarkedets Tillægspension (ATP) has been urged to cull risk, establish formal portfolio benchmarks and reduce private markets exposures, according to an external review committee which handed down a 536-page report into the fund’s investment operations after an 18-month review. Following the release of the report by the board this week, co-author of the review Andrew Ang unpacks the findings with Top1000funds.com.
